First of all, sexting can lead to an invasion of privacy. Once something is sent electronically, it is no longer under the sender's control; anyone with access to the recipient's phone can view the content. This could potentially put someone at risk for embarrassment and humiliation if their private messages become public knowledge. Furthermore, it could also open up opportunities for blackmail or extortion from malicious individuals who gain access to such intimate information.
Moreover, sexting can be illegal depending on the age of those involved and the content that is shared. In some states, minors may be charged with child pornography if they send nude photos or other graphic material through text message without parental consent. Even if both parties willingly take part in such activities, there may still be legal repercussions at hand. Thus, it is important that young people understand the full implications of their actions before engaging in sexting behavior.
